About the Role
We are looking for a Mobile Forklift Engineer to join a well-established materials handling business. This is a predominantly mobile position, attending customer sites to service, maintain and repair forklift trucks and warehouse equipment. There may also be occasional workshop-based work when required.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ced Forklift Engineer, although candidates with a strong mechanical background from industries such as plant, HGV, agricultural or construction equipment will also be considered. Full on-the-job training is available for the right candidate.
Key Responsibilities
- Service, maintain and repair forklift trucks and material handling equipment.
- Diagnose and rectify mechanical, hydraulic and electrical faults.
- Carry out planned preventative maintenance and emergency breakdown repairs.
- Complete service reports and relevant job documentation accurately.
- Deliver a high standard of customer service while working on client sites.
- Ensure all work is completed safely and in line with company procedures.
- Assist with workshop-based repairs and servicing when required.
